Title:  Colubrines 
Molecular Formula:  C22H24N2O3 
Molecular Weight:  364.44 
Percent Composition:  C 72.50%, H 6.64%, N 7.69%, O 13.17% 
Literature References:  Minor alkaloids found in Strychnos nux vomica L.; naturally occurring in two chemically distinct forms, a and b.  Isolation from mother liquor of commercial strychnine extraction:  K. Warnat, Helv. Chim. Acta 14, 997 (1931).  Isolation and characterization from S. nux vomica L.:  G. B. Marini-Bettolo et al., J. Assoc. Off. Anal. Chem. 51, 185 (1968).  Structure of a- and b-colubrine:  S. P. Findlay, J. Am. Chem. Soc. 73, 3008 (1951); of b-colubrine:  P. Rosenmund, Ber. 95, 2639 (1962); of a-colubrine:  J. M. Culver, M. Sainsbury, J. Chem. Res. Synop. 1987, 304.  Synthesis from strychnine:  P. Rosenmund, H. Franke, Ber. 97, 1677 (1964).  Determn by GLC:  N. G. Bisset, P. Fouché, J. Chromatogr. 37, 172 (1968); by HPLC:  G. M. Iskander et al., J. Liq. Chromatogr. 5, 1481 (1982).  Chiroptical properties of b-colubrine:  J. W. Snow, T. M. Hooker, Jr., Can. J. Chem. 56, 1222 (1978). 
  
Derivative Type:  a-Colubrine  
CAS Registry Number:  509-44-4 
Additional Names:  3-Methoxystrychnidin-10-one;  11-methoxystrychnine 
Properties:  Pyramids from ethyl acetate, mp 189-193°.  [a]D20 -72.4° (c = 0.9 in alc).  uv max (ethanol):  255, 297 nm (log e 4.03, 3.77).  Sol in alc, benzene, chloroform.

Derivative Type:  b-Colubrine  
CAS Registry Number:  509-36-4 
Additional Names:  2-Methoxystrychnidin-10-one;  10-methoxystrychnine 
Properties:  Crystals from dil alcohol, mp 222°.  Very bitter.  [a]D19 -107.7° (c = 2.5 in 80% alcohol).  [a]D21 -156° (c = 0.042 in chloroform).  uv max (ethanol):  262, 297 nm (log e 4.40, 3.80).  Sol in alcohol, benzene, chloroform.
